Service + Advocacy = Stronger Communities
|
As we observe Martin Luther King Jr. Day, we’re reminded that it’s not just a day of remembrance but an opportunity for action. Across our communities, volunteers will roll up their sleeves to get involved and give back, reflecting Dr. King’s vision of collective responsibility and shared humanity. From food pantries and shelters to arts groups and environmental organizations, nonprofits across North Carolina rely on and appreciate the volunteers that turn their compassion into impact.
Showing up can also mean using our voices. Simple things like keeping up with what’s going on with your community organizations, talking about it with friends and neighbors, and letting decision-makers know why nonprofits matter are everyday advocacy, and help nonprofits by raising awareness of community challenges and needs that lead to better policies.
